Subject: Health check cut-over complete — for Wednesday's sync

The Marrowgate API fleet now uses the new deep health checks behind the Kestrel load balancer. Old TCP-only checks are retired. The new endpoint verifies database connectivity and queue depth before reporting healthy, so instances under backpressure drain gracefully instead of flapping. Cut-over happened in two waves with zero dropped requests. One node was slow to pass its first deep check; threshold tuning fixed it. Current balancer settings for the fleet follow.

deployment values, yadug-bawif:
[framir]
team = pelox
access_code = ac_a38ab2
owner = tamion.julael
host = framir.tolvaqlabs.test
port = 11211
peer = tammir.zemvargrid.local
salt = 2215ef03
pin = 1541

- [ ] Step 7: Archive cold storage buckets (Glacierline tier). Confirm both ceremony witnesses are present, verify bucket manifests match the Oxbow ledger, then seal the archive key shares. Plugin authors may observe but not handle shares. Once sealed, the archive index itself is encrypted and can only be reopened with the passphrase below.

vault phrase of badup-hahig = tamael-aldael-kelmir-istael-fenok-istwyn-tamius-jorath-oliion

**Vendor note: Inkmill markdown pipeline**

Rendering for Parchway docs is outsourced to Inkmill under an annual contract, renewing each March. They handle sanitization and PDF export; we own the upload queue. SLA: 4-hour response on rendering failures. Escalate only after two failed retries. Their support desk is reachable at the address below.

billing contact of hahaf-baguf = zorael.tammir.jorius@sivrelhq.internal

If the Huewarden contrast scanner reports zero violations on a page known to fail, the crawler has usually been blocked before styles load. Check that the audit agent's user string is allowlisted in the target's edge config, and confirm computed styles are available by running a single-page scan with --wait-for-paint. Timeouts under 5s frequently cause silent empty results; raise to 15s for heavy pages. The scanner's API itself requires authentication on every run; invoke it with the bearer token below.

login token, kajef-bageg: eyJhbGciOiJIUzI1NiIsInR5cCI6IkpXVCJ9.eyJzdWIiOiIH5ZQCtYjwtIn0.4vgGyGsw5y_7